Mohawk Loop Envelopes

Mohawk Loop envelopes are a complete collection of extremely high postconsumer waste recycled envelopes. With a range of print surfaces and fashionable palette of whites, pastels, jewel tones and earthy fibered shades, Loop envelopes enable environmental responsibility the Mohawk way.
